About This Event

The Bovine Classic 2026 is a relatively new event billed tongue in cheek as “America’s 4th Hardest, Cow-Themed, Wine Country Experience” and an event that our team at Strambecco considers one of the Best Gravel Cycling Events in the Southwest and California. The event occurs in the Paso Robles wine region, a great, albeit under-the-radar, cycling region, and is co-produced by Bike Monkey and Locomotiv Performance Coaching. Bike Monkey, in particular, is behind many great events in the greater NorCal region, and participants in its inaugural event gave rave reviews, many going so far as to say it’s the best gravel event/race they’ve ever participated in.

What makes this The Bovine Classic 2026 truly distinct are its creatively planned courses with provisioned aid stations, ensuring riders are well taken care of throughout the journey, and the post-ride celebration brimming with beer, lunch, live music, and a DJ, offering a vibrant atmosphere for participants to unwind and rejoice. The weekend is dotted with pre-rides, such as the Sponsored Pre-Ride in Paso Robles and the unique “Fried Pickle” Pre-Ride at The LongBranch Saloon. The Bovine Classic benefits Operation Surf, which creates healing and recovery surfing programs for injured veterans.

The Bovine Classic, known for its mass-start rollout, unfolds on four mixed-surface course options, presenting a divergent range of scenic beauty and challenges. Multiple timed segments peppered across the courses provide cyclists with the chance to compete for podium prizes awarded to overall segment winners. Each course includes a healthy dose of dirt and asphalt riding.

Labelled as a ‘beefy burger’ of a ride, the Big Bovine route incorporates about 40+ miles of dirt over a 100-mile course. Riders will navigate long climbs, numerous Belgian-style rollers, and an invigorating 1-mile stretch of single track with a total elevation gain of nearly 9,400ft. For fields with over 30 riders, the top five cyclists by category will be awarded prizes.

The Feisty Bovine route follows much of the Big Bovine course but avoids the single-track out to Creston. Characterized as ‘feisty,’ this calf has significant climbing, promising a ride with a kick! The course totals 73 miles with almost 7,400 ft of climbing.

The Happy Bovine introduces riders to the 1.5-mile single-track stampede out to Creston, ensuring a stop at Long Branch Saloon. This route offers all participants a taste of this new terrain over 64 miles with 5,000+ ft. of elevation gain.

For those who fancy a beautiful, less intense ride, Baby Bovine is a treasure with a course boasting 37 miles and over 3,100 ft. of climbing. Featuring one long climb up Kiler Canyon, followed by a picturesque jaunt under a sprawling oak canopy, it’s a serene journey.

Each course is fortified with unique and well-stocked aid stations, along with on-course support, including SAG vehicles, motos, and ride marshals. Post-ride festivities kick off with a lively party complete with refreshing beer, a scrumptious lunch, and engaging music by a DJ and live band. The timed segments across the routes hold the key to cyclists’ final positions, with the best overall segment time determining the winner in all fields.

Bike Monkey is a California-based event production company renowned for organizing high-quality cycling races and adventure rides while also focusing on community engagement and charitable efforts. The company was founded with the mission to combine a passion for cycling with philanthropy, using its events to raise funds for various causes. Bike Monkey events range from gravel races to road cycling, offering diverse challenges for cyclists of all skill levels.

Charities Supported

Bike Monkey integrates charity into many of its events, supporting various causes, including environmental conservation, public land protection, and disaster relief. For example:

  • The NorCal High School Cycling League: Bike Monkey supports youth development in cycling by raising funds for this league, which encourages high school students to participate in mountain biking as a sport.
  • Santa Rosa Fire Recovery: After devastating wildfires in Northern California, Bike Monkey contributed to local recovery efforts, raising significant funds to help affected communities rebuild.
  • Be Good™ Foundation: Many events, such as Rebecca’s Private Idaho, support this foundation, focusing on empowerment and healing through cycling.

Prominent Events

  1. Levi’s GranFondo
    This is one of Bike Monkey’s most well-known events, attracting thousands of riders annually. Hosted in Santa Rosa, California, it offers a variety of routes, from beginner-friendly to extremely challenging, all through beautiful Northern California landscapes. Proceeds benefit local charities and environmental causes.
  2. Fish Rock
    Known for its tough gravel course, this event takes riders through the rugged terrain of Mendocino County, California. The ride combines scenic beauty with grueling climbs and gravel roads, and it raises awareness for local land conservation efforts.
  3. Rebecca’s Private Idaho
    Co-produced with Rebecca Rusch, this gravel event in Idaho combines stunning mountain terrain with charity fundraising for the Be Good™ Foundation. Riders can choose from multiple route options, making it accessible for varying skill levels while supporting a meaningful cause.

Bike Monkey is widely respected in the cycling community for delivering well-organized and challenging events and for its ongoing commitment to supporting charitable causes through the power of cycling.
